Diagnostic Trouble Code (DTC) Information
Diagnostic trouble code (DTC) information CEM-6C54
Condition
Hint: The diagnostic trouble codes (DTCs) are included in a larger fault-tracing for the symptom Starter motor not running.
The central electronic module (CEM) checks the functions in the start inhibiting system. The start inhibiting system includes a number of control modules. When attempting to start, the central electronic module (CEM) checks the included components via encrypted communication.
The diagnostic trouble code (DTC) is stored if the central electronic module (CEM) receives an incorrect answer from the engine control module (ECM).
Substitute value
- None.
Possible source
- Incorrect programming of the engine control module (ECM)
- Incorrect programming of the central electronic module (CEM).
Fault symptom[s]
- The starter motor does not turn
